A wonderful location is" The Madison Hotel" on St. Germaine Blvd. Very close to the Seine and all the charm of the left bank. A 13 yr. old would also enjoy all the nighttime activities--rollerbladers,street musicians, students hanging out, etc. Friday night around Notre Dame is something to be seen.
Right bank is more like New York.

Hotel Le Clement, 6, rue Clement in the 6th.I've stayed in this area, almost annually, since the early 80s.
The Hotel le Clement is a 5-minute walk from the abovementioned Madison Hotel and much less expensive. Get a room on a high floor and facing the street as those rooms are best. It's on a rather quiet street, on a square. I usually have problems sleeping in Paris, but not in this hotel. I put in the foam ear plugs and sleep like a baby.
